It goes without saying that the landline is about to go the way of the dodo – and it is nice to see a modern piece of technology like the iPhone bridging the gap between the old and the new. This particular setup that you see here will cost you somewhere in the region of $30, where you can still relive the good old days of holding a receiver in your hand while you carry out a conversation. Basically, your iPhone is the conduit between the past and present, and it is nice to know that you can always check out other apps on the iPhone or look up information even when you’re talking.

Heck, there is also the option to place the person on the other side of the line on speakerphone if you want to. Since this is not an iPhone only device, you can also opt to use your iPod touch with it.
